James River Animal Hospital Introduce
Serving the Nixa, Missouri, region and surrounding communities, **James River Animal Hospital** operates as a full-service veterinary practice that distinguishes itself through its dedication to a remarkably diverse patient base. While providing routine, high-quality care for **Cats** and **Small Animals** like dogs, the hospital holds specialized expertise in treating **Animals And Exotics**, including **Birds**, **Reptiles**, **Rodents**, and **Small Mammals** like ferrets and guinea pigs. This breadth of knowledge makes it a highly valuable resource for Missouri residents who own less common companions.
The hospital’s philosophy centers on delivering **Compassionate Care** and making advanced veterinary services accessible. Their approach is highly comprehensive, covering everything from wellness and prevention to complex diagnostic work and surgical interventions. For routine health, they emphasize preventative care through regular **Health Examinations** and **Dietary Counseling**. When more serious issues arise, they utilize modern diagnostics like **Pet Ultrasound**, **Pet X-Rays**, and an **In-House Laboratory** for rapid **Blood Work** analysis. This ability to handle a vast range of species and conditions under one roof, with a strong focus on affordability, is often highlighted by satisfied local customers.
Customer reviews consistently commend the exceptional attention and expertise provided by the staff, particularly with exotic pets. As one client happily stated, the staff are "very attentive and caring for my babies" (ferrets), finding the services "very affordable for what they do." Another review praised the successful treatment of an abscess on an old skinless guinea pig, noting that the veterinary team did an "amazing job" and were "extremely affordable," avoiding the high costs often found elsewhere. The warm, welcoming atmosphere is even enhanced by a resident bird named Jasper, who is playfully referred to as a "great receptionist."
In addition to medical and surgical care, James River Animal Hospital offers necessary supplementary services such as a **Pet Boarding** facility and on-site **Pet Groomer** services. The combination of comprehensive medical services, specialized exotic pet care, and convenient amenities positions the hospital as a trusted and convenient hub for total pet wellness in the Nixa area. They are committed to being a partner in pet health, a dedication that has been the foundation of the practice since its establishment in 1985.

- This animal hospital is awesome. I travel from Carterville, 74 miles away, BECAUSE of the great Dr. Hardy and an amazing staff who are friendly, sweet, knowledgeable, and make me feel comfortable. They treat birds, exotics (rabbits, ferrets, rats, among others), reptiles (lizards, turtles, snakes, etc...), cats, and dogs. Their prices are great too. I couldn't imagine taking my fur babies to any other Veterinarian Hospital. April 09 · Glenn
